Faulty headlight lands man in jail after police find meth, marijuana

BEDFORD – A Bloomington man was arrested after a Lawrence County Sheriff’s Department deputy spotted a 2017 GMC Sierra on State Road 37 near the Oolitic stop light with a headlight and a taillight out.

The driver, 46-year-old Christopher Head was stopped on State Road 37 just north of Salt Creek Bridge.

The officer also found the license plate was expired.

Head told the officer he was on his way to work. Police then learned Head was wanted on an outstanding warrant in Greene County. Head was detained.

Oolitic canine Deny Joe arrived on the scene and alerted officers to drugs in the vehicle.

During a search of the truck, police found multiple illegal items including a glass smoking device with meth inside, baggies with 1.48 grams of meth inside, a baggie of marijuana, six marijuana cigarettes, and two bottles of urine.

Head was then charged with possession of meth and marijuana, and possession of drug paraphernalia.

Jackson’s Heavy Haul towed the truck.
